Get a key fob
A key fob can be used to control the system of the vehicle. It has a battery and a chip inside that sends signals to the car that allow it to unlock the doors or start the engine. Modern cars require a keyfob to operate. These can be bought at the dealer or a locksmith. Finding the best one for your vehicle can be a bit difficult. You may need to make a few tries but with perseverance you'll find the right one.

If your key fob has become lost, you need to find a replacement as soon as possible. It can be very expensive to replace a key fob, and if you don't have a spare you might not be able to operate your vehicle.
You can save money by programming your key fob yourself. The majority of car manufacturers provide an easy way to program a new keyfob. This method can be used to program an entirely new key fob in your home or office. The procedure may differ from one vehicle to the next, but the basic steps are the identical. The first step is to take off the old key fob. Then, replace the battery. The majority times, it is a small watch or calculator battery that is available in most pharmacies as well as home improvement stores.
You have to program the new keyfob within a specific period of time, which is typically between 10 and 30 seconds. This can be accomplished by pressing both the lock and unlock buttons at the same time. When the car is able to recognize the new key fob it will turn off the door locks or emit a chime to indicate that the process has been completed.
Buy a car key programmer
A car key programmer is a device that is used to modify the key of a vehicle. These tools are designed for professionals in the field of automobiles and are compatible with a wide range of vehicles. They also allow you to program the latest keys, and alter the IMMO structure of the car. Certain of these tools can be used on the go. Key programmer tools can assist you in obtaining the replacement key fob in case of theft.
Many cars today require special chips inside their keys as an added security measure. These chips make it difficult to duplicate keys and are exclusive to the vehicle they're associated with. This is a positive thing, but it can make it difficult to replace lost or stolen keys as the chip will need to be modified.
The process of programming a new car key is relatively straightforward and involves following the directions that are included with the key and chip. It is best to leave the job to an auto dealer or locksmith, as they have the necessary tools and the knowledge to complete it quickly.
A professional will have to first determine the car's make, model and year, which will enable them to determine the right blank keys and the equipment needed for the job. They will then read the current information on the EEPROM and use it to program the fob or remote key. The process is relatively easy and can be completed by a trusted auto locksmith or dealer in a matter of minutes.
The key programmer needs to be connected to the OBD-II port of the vehicle in order to communicate with it. This will reset the computer and transponder to accept a key. With a special tool technicians can create the new key from one that is already in use. Once the new key has been programmed, it will function like a regular car key. Reprogramming keys is quicker and more affordable than purchasing a replacement.
Find a locksmith
Whether you need to program your car keys or want to get an apartment intercom system, you can find the right locksmiths. They can also provide assistance with security upgrades. Some locksmiths specialize in particular locks, while others install an entirely new security system. They can also rekey locks to ensure that they work with fresh keys.
Most people call locksmiths after they've locked themselves out of their home or office. It can happen when they forget their keys or if someone has a mistake closing the door behind them. Locksmiths is able to open the lock by using either the master key or the Jiggle Key. They can also cut new keys for doors, windows and safes.
Locksmiths typically need to use specialized software and computers to programme the keys for automobiles. These programs are complicated and require regular updates. Locksmiths must also purchase a lot of tokens to use with the computer systems. This can be expensive.
